Teacher's Day Celebration


19th May 2011/15 Jamadil Akhir 1432 (Thursday)



16th May - The official Teacher's Day Celebration in Malaysia. However, Kolej Matrikulasi Teknikal Johor (KMTJ) celebrated the auspicious day on 19th May 2011. We sang the mandatory national anthem,Negara Ku followed by the state song, Bangsa Johor. The teaching staff aka lecturers sang with gusto Lagu Guru Malaysia. We had a cake-cutting ceremony headed by the Director, En. Zaidi bin Yazid. Gifts were also exchanged by drawing lots among the lecturers and support staff. At noon, we had tahlil & doa selamat kesyukuran. For the feast, it was nasi briyani donated collectively by those who got promoted to DG 52 (yours truly), DG 48 & DG 44. I baked chocolate moist (my favourite recipe) for the pot luck contribution.

ENGLISH LANGUAGE MINI CARNIVAL KMTJ 2011

10 MARCH 2011
The Technocrat Voice Club (TVC) members under the guidance of En. Abdul Razak bin A. Rahim, Head of the English Unit organized a mini carnival in March. Activities included an argumentative essay writing competition (Teenagers nowadays are disrespectful of the elders. Do you agree?), pop quiz and scrabble. I was one of the judges for the essay and I must admit, a few students conveyed good points as food for thought. Pop quiz was conducted in class. It was hilarious and no doubt very noisy when students tried to outdo each other in their pursuit for excellence. Even though marks were deducted for wrong answers that never deter them. They laughed out loud when other groups got their marks deducted but when it was their own group, the story took a different tune. That's normal. However, it was good to see them letting their hair down - released tension and enjoyed themselves. (Final exams: 11 - 20 April 2011). Prize giving ceremony was on 10th March, after class. Nur Izzaty from C1T4 went on stage to receive the prize for her group - champion in pop quiz. Nina Syazwani from the same class, a member of the TVC lent a hand to help convey prizes. Malam Dinamika KMTJ 2011

4th March 2011 (Dewan Teknokrat, KMTJ)
One of my responsibilities as Head of Department was to officiate functions and the like. Students organized everything, from the date, venue, VIP , guests, entertainment, menu and even serving guests with proper cutlery too. The theme was black and white (like the Black & White Minstrel Show, I thought). My kebaya was white, anyway and the sarong, black batik with white motif - last minute shopping at Pontian Mall.I admit that the female students dressed up for the occassion and they were resplendent. The food served was nice and I felt amused when the committee members who sat together with me at the VIP table got to be at their best behaviour (they were being assessed for their coursework). How relieved they were when I broke the ice and told them to take it easy. The entertainment segment mostly dwelled on loud music akin to the young ones. It's their world. Age is just a number and it reminded me of my three teenagers and their preference of music. To each his own. Thank you (students and lecturers) for doing a good job. The poses they had for their album would no doubt be fond memories of life at KMTJ.
